CVE-2025-38681

CVE-2025-38681 affects the Linux kernel mm/ptdump code. The issue arises when memory hotplug modifications race with ptdump_walk_pgd() and intermediate page-table frees, causing the ptdump code to dereference freed memory and potentially crash or corrupt data.
